 Dramatized Moot Court – Civil Case – Bhanu Prakash Vs Amaravati

A moot court event provides law students with a platform to practice and refine their legal skills in a simulated courtroom setting. Participants act as advocates, presenting arguments for both sides of a fictional case before a panel of judges. The objective is to enhance their legal research, analytical thinking, and oral advocacy skills. Through this process, students improve their ability to construct persuasive arguments, think critically, and respond effectively under pressure. Moot court also fosters teamwork and professionalism, preparing students for real-world legal practice.

For students, participating in a moot court enhances their legal research, analytical reasoning, and oral advocacy skills. It helps them build confidence in public speaking, develop teamwork, and gain practical insights into courtroom procedures. For faculty members, moot court provides an opportunity to mentor students, assess their understanding of legal principles, and contribute to their professional growth.

Faculty can also refine their teaching strategies by observing how students apply legal theory in practice. Both students and faculty benefit from engaging in real-world legal challenges through this interactive learning experience.
